The Importance of Blockchain Security

Blockchain security is at the forefront of technology, impacting various sectors—from finance to healthcare. The reliance on decentralized systems poses unique challenges, and understanding these vulnerabilities is akin to knowing the workings of a bank vault for digital assets.

  • Vulnerability assessments: Regular testing to identify weaknesses.
  • Multi-signature wallets: Ensuring that multiple parties authorize transactions for security.
  • Smart contract audits: Reviewing code for potential loopholes before deployment.

Common Security Best Practices for 2025

As the blockchain ecosystem continues to grow, adopting best practices will be crucial in safeguarding your digital assets. Here are some actionable techniques:

  • Use of hardware wallets: Storing assets offline to prevent hacks.
  • Regular software updates: Ensuring wallets and applications are up-to-date to patch vulnerabilities.
  • Awareness of phishing attempts: Training users to avoid suspicious communications.
